The Security Guy & CIA Spy Podcast, Episode 34
From trading data on the dark web to deepfakes: The high-stakes world of cybersecurity
In this episode, Peter Warmka and Robert Siciliano discuss an International sting that brings down a major dark web marketplace, Top Salary for Cybercriminals Can Exceed $1M and Twitter 2FA changes.
They also talk about how to avoid maybe getting locked out of your account and Can YOU spot a deepfake from a real person? World's first 'certified' deep fake warns viewers not to trust everything they see online.
